EDIF is an emerging de facto industry standard for the interchange of electronic design information. Its eventual aim is to encompass all the data required to describe the design and manufacture of electronic equipments. The initial specification, published in March 1985, focuses on the transfer of basic data for semi-custom very large-scale integration design, but planned extensions in later versions will include printed circuit board design as well. This paper presents an overview of the language, the current state and future trends.
